When typing a sentence a character repeats aboooooooout 10 times, or as 'about' above ;). I tested with a new kernel today, 2.6.25-rc7-git-something and the problem is still present. With 2.6.25-rc3 the keyboard is fine, and I've not tried with any kernel in between. As a side note, timestamps gets mixed up in dmesg output in a 1-2 second span. Maybe related? This is on a HP dv2140eu laptop, x86_64 SMP.
